Metro station
Horto is a Belo Horizonte Metro station on Line 1. It was opened in December 1992 as a one-station extension of the line from ; later, was added in the middle of this extension.

Metro station
Santa Inês is a Belo Horizonte Metro station on Line 1. It was opened in December 1994 as a one-station extension of the line from . In April 1997 the line was extended to . The station is located between Horto and .
